Introduction

Rollerblades for men are an exciting way to enjoy outdoor activities while getting a great workout. These skates are designed with comfort and performance in mind, making them ideal for both beginners and seasoned skaters. With a variety of styles and features available, choosing the right rollerblades can enhance your skating experience.

When selecting rollerblades, consider the following factors:
  • Wheel Size: Larger wheels provide more speed, while smaller wheels offer better maneuverability.
  • Frame Material: Aluminum frames are durable and lightweight, while plastic frames are more affordable.
  • Boot Type: Hard boots offer more support, while soft boots provide more comfort.

Rollerblading not only promotes cardiovascular fitness but also improves balance and coordination. Whether you're skating in the park, on a trail, or in your neighborhood, rollerblades for men are a fun way to stay active.

Regular maintenance, such as checking wheel wear and brake functionality, can ensure a safe and enjoyable skating experience. Remember to wear protective gear, like helmets and knee pads, to enhance safety while skating.
